Bournemouth manager Eddie Howe believes that David Brooks can fill in at central midfield when necessary.
The Cherries are facing injury issues, with Jefferson Lerma, Dan Gosling, Lewis Cook and Andrew Surman all out.
It means that Brooks had to play in the heart of midfield against Newcastle. And Howe was impressed with how he equipped himself in the position.
He told the Daily Echo: "Brooksy did really well when you consider it is a big shift from wide to central.
"We have not done a lot of work with him tactically and he is just a very good player that can play in different positions, which is great for us to have that versatility. I thought Jeff and Brooksy did very well."
